Professor Sae-Joon Park's research lab specializes in structural engineering and environmental remediation, with a focus on enhancing the seismic and wind-resistant performance of civil infrastructure such as cable-stayed bridges and water tanks. The lab also conducts advanced research on advanced oxidation processes for industrial wastewater treatment, particularly targeting recalcitrant pollutants like dyes and oxalic acid. Key research directions include innovative structural systems (e.g., partially earth-anchored cable systems), performance evaluation of steel-concrete composite connections, and optimization of AOPs for sustainable water treatment.

오존, UV, TiO2를 이용한 고급산화공정의 옥살산 제거효율 평가
강준원, 송승주, 박세준, 강민구

본 연구에서는 오존, UV, TiO2를 이용한 고급산화공정의 옥살산 제거효율을 평가하였다. 오존, UV, TiO2를 각각 단독으로 적용하거나 다양하게 혼합 적용시킨 고급산화처리 후 옥살산 제거효율들을 비교한 결과, 오존/UV/TiO2 공정에서 가장 산화효능이 높게 나타났다. 수중에 잔류하는 옥살산 농도와 TOC 농도간의 상관성을 확인하였고, 각 공정별로 유사하게 나타난 옥살산 제거경향과 TOC 저감경향의 비교를 통해서 옥살산의 분해는 거의 완전산화가 이루어진다는 것을 알 수 있었다.

교량의 재가설 공사기간에 따른 사용자비용 평가
김상효, 박세준, 이동호, 안진희
한국구조물진단유지관리공학회 논문집

교량구조물은 사회물류흐름에 필요한 중요한 역할을 하는 사회간접시설물로 공용수명이 다하거나 지진, 폭풍 등의 자연재해에 따라 구조물의 손상이 발생할 경우 기존 교량을 철거하고 재가설 하여야 한다. 공용중인 교량을 재가설할 경우, 차량의 우회, 교통체증에 따른 사용자비용과 공사기간동안의 소음, 분진 등에 따른 사회비용이 발생하게 된다. 하지만 교량의 재가설에따른 사용자비용과 사회비용은 교량건설시 고려되지 않고, 이를 평가하는 방법 또한 모호하므로 이를 적용한 교량형식이 선정되지 못하고 있다. 따라서 본 연구에서는 교량의 재가설시 발생되는 사회적 간접비용, 즉 사용자의 사회적, 경제적 가치를 파악하여 교량 재가설에 따른 사용자비용의 평가방법을 제안하고 이를 평가하였다. 사용자비용의 평가 시 교량의 일교통량, 첨두시간, 우회거리, 우회시간 등을 포함한 교통정보와 사회적 물동량이 고려되었으며, 차량운행비용과 교량 재가설에 따른 시간지연비용 또한 고려되었다.

조적식 구조물의 부분 매입식 격자철근 보강기법의 내진 성능 평가
김상효, 최문석, 박세준, 안진희
한국구조물진단유지관리공학회 논문집

조적조 구조물은 전 세계적으로 중·저층 주거시설, 상업시설, 종교용 건축물, 학교, 관공서 등의 용도로 폭넓게 사용되어 왔다. 그러나 조적벽체는 조적개체와 모르타르의 이질재료를 접착하여 쌓는 방식의 구조벽체로 지진과 같은 횡력 발생 시 접착력을 잃거나 미끄러지면서 파괴될 수 있다. 본 연구는 이러한 문제점을 해결하고자 조적식 구조물의 내진보강 기법을 제안하였으며, 진동대 실험을 통하여 내진 성능을 검증하였다. 진동대 실험 결과, 본 연구에서 제안한 내진보강 기법을 이용한 벽체는 한국 건축설계기준이 제시하는 내진 기준인 0.14g와 미국 IBC에서 제시하는 내진 기준인 0.4g에서 모두 최종 파괴에 도달하지 않았다. 그러나, 0.14g 이상의 지진을 경험한 면외방향 실험체의 경우 급격한 강성저하가 관찰되어, 적절한 보수·보강이 필요할 것으로 예측된다.
